Original Description
Christoffer Wilhelm Eckersberg’s Three Women in Classic Dresses Symbolizing the Three Artforms at the Academy of Fine Arts (1817) is a masterful Neoclassical work that radiates harmony and intellectual elegance. The painting depicts three allegorical female figures, each embodying sculpture, painting, and architecture, standing gracefully against a serene backdrop. Eckersberg, often called the "father of Danish painting," employs crisp lines, balanced composition, and restrained yet warm colors to create a sense of refined idealism. The work reflects his academic rigor and his time studying under Jacques-Louis David in Paris, blending Danish clarity with international Neoclassical principles. As a foundational piece in Denmark’s Golden Age of art, it not only celebrates artistic disciplines but also exemplifies Eckersberg’s role in elevating Danish art to European prominence. The painting’s quiet dignity and pedagogical symbolism make it a touchstone for understanding 19th-century academic art.
